If your going for mostly highway driving, think twice about going mt/s, your gonna die with the road noise, on the work truck i drive we have km2's on it, and they are loud, i can hear them over the diesel, and the 7.3 is kinda loud.
Also once a set of mt/s start to wear, they'll just start wearing faster, and faster, especially if you get cheapo ones.

Go for a set of 33 at/s, running 4.10s with that you should be fine. But it wont be as responsive. A 3 in body and 3 in spindle will be fine, no need for a 1.5in leveling kit.
